Luxury fashion and automotive companies are expanding beyond their traditional domains by building high-end residential towers worldwide. These exclusive properties offer a lifestyle that encapsulates the essence of iconic brands, from interior designs to supercar garages built within the apartments, with a special glass car elevator.
Dubai and later Miami became the first cities where branded residences came to market. In 2010, high end fashion houses broached the real estate market with Residence Burj Khalifa, designed by Giorgio Armani.
Since then, front runner such as Fendi, Missoni, Roberto Cavalli and Elie Saab have moved from the runway to waterfront housing developments on both sides of the Atlantic.

Porsche Design Tower, Miami
On the coast of Miami, automotive manufacturers compete with luxury clothing brands to provide the ultimate luxury residence. The Porsche Design Tower in Sunny Isles Beach was the first condominium in which residents can deliver their car to the apartment in a special glass elevator, Aston Martin is selling penthouses in the branded 66-floor skyscraper with the Vulkan supercar as an add-on benefit. And Bentley Residences is due to arrive in Miami in 2026 – the sparkling structure features a glass-walled garage in every unit.
Now, the trend has made its way to the Costa Del Sol, Europe’s most coveted real estate destination; the first hotspots to house branded residential projects will be Marbella and Málaga.

Sierra Blanca Estates is at the helm in Spain, overseeing three major developments wise investors are keeping their eyes on.
The gated complex Epic Marbella created in collaboration with Fendi Casa stretches along the exclusive Golden Mile. Karl Lagerfeld Villas Marbella is set to be built on a plot located between the Penibaetic mountains and the coastline. Dolce & Gabbana moves to Marbella with a collection of 60 super-luxury residences that form the third and most significant part of Marbella Design Hills, a new €250m neighborhood developed by Sierra Blanca Estates.

Epic Marbella by Fendi Casa
Price: $4.65 million (approx)
Location: Golden Mile, Marbella


Epic Marbella is a luxury development in idyllic surroundings that’s currently under construction. When complete, there will be 20 apartments across five buildings, each with terraces and interiors by Fendi Casa. Ground floor units will boast a private garden, and this middle-level four-bedroom and bathroom property will span 4,747 square feet and come complete with first-rate communal facilities including a large pool, a sun deck, and landscaped gardens.
Grand Bleu Tower by Elie Saab
Price: $1.73 million (approx)
Location: Dubai Harbour


The first residential building by fashion icon Elie Saab, Grand Bleu Tower is set in the heart of Emaar Beachfront and features chic apartments that are all about contemporary luxury and sweeping vistas of Palm Jumeirah. This two-bedroom and three-bathroom corner condo with floor-to-ceiling windows looks out to the Persian Gulf, covers 1,150 square feet, and has private beach access. Communal facilities range from a state-of-the-art gym and inviting infinity pools to underground parking.
Cavalli Tower by DAMAC
Price: $5.7 million (approx)
Location: Dubai Marina


Offering deluxe beach and Palm-facing apartments, Cavalli Tower is a striking 70-story architectural masterpiece with a health club, a sizable gymnasium, a pool, 24-hour security, and access to the Westin Mina Seyahi. This three-bedroom and four-bathroom duplex will span 4,056 square feet and offer high-spec finishes and bold designs by Roberto Cavalli, plus a kitchen fitted with artwork and wonderful Palm Jumeirah outlooks.

Porsche Design Tower
Price: $4.8 million
Location: Sunny Isles Beach, Miami


This upscale apartment building has 132 residential units, each with sleek interiors and in-unit garages thanks to “The Dezervator”, a one-of-a-kind elevator that transports owners and their cars to their homes. Best-in-class communal amenities range from a private cinema and a water-facing outdoor lounge to chilled wine lockers and a golf simulator. This three-bedroom and four-bathroom 3,171-square-foot residence benefits from a heated saltwater pool on the balcony and crisp white décor.
